These enchiladas pair beautifully with a fresh garden salad, perhaps with a tangy vinaigrette to cut through the richness of the cheese. A side of sautéed green beans or roasted Brussels sprouts would add a lovely touch of green to your plate. For a true Midwestern touch, consider serving with a dollop of sour cream and a sprinkle of fresh cilantro on top.
Low Carb Baked Chicken Enchiladas
Servings: 4
Like Low Carb for more
Ingredients
2 cups cooked chicken breast, shredded
1 cup enchilada sauce
1 cup shredded cheese (cheddar or Monterey Jack)
8 low-carb tortillas
1 cup shredded lettuce or cabbage
1/2 cup diced tomatoes
1/4 cup chopped onions
1/4 cup chopped fresh cilantro
1 tablespoon olive oil
Salt and pepper to taste
